SOCOMEC DIRIS 48250201 Multi-function Power Meter

Marca: SOCOMEC

Código do modelo: DIRIS 48250201

Série de produtos: DIRIS A40 Multi-function Power Meter

Complete Order Code: 48250201

Informações essenciais

  1. Nome completo do produto

DIRIS A40 Multi-function Energy / Power Monitoring Meter

Código do pedido: 48250201

  1. Configuração padrão (Modelo 48250201)

Medição: Three-phase voltage, atual, poder, fator de potência, harmonic, medição de energia

Comunicação: Modbus RS485

Dimensão: 96×96mm panel mounting

Fonte de energia: AC/DC 80–270V

Entrada: Direct voltage input up to 480V; current input requires external CT

Funções: Demanda, Harmônico THD, registro de eventos, time-of-use energy

Saída: Basic version without built-in I/O (Select other variants for relay/pulse output)

  1. Reference for Distinguishing Similar Models

48250201: DIRIS A40, Modbus, No I/O

48250202: Version with pulse output

48250203: Version with digital input / saída de relé

Aplicações Típicas

Aparelhagem de baixa tensão, busbar cabinets, UPS incoming feeders, data center power distribution, factory energy consumption monitoring; interfacing with SCADA, PLC and energy management systems.

Modbus RTU Register Summary for SOCOMEC DIRIS A40 (Número do pedido. 48250201)

Important Prerequisites

  1. Protocolo: Modbus RTU, Código de Função 03 (Read Holding Registers). All measurement data are stored in holding registers;
  2. Data format: 32-bit signed/unsigned integer (occupies two consecutive 16-bit registers, Big-Endian, high word first);
  3. Address in manual = decimal offset address (PDU address, starts at 0)

For configuration software using 4xxxx format: Offset address + 40001

Exemplo: Desvio 786 → Register 40787

  1. Raw values need scaling division to obtain actual engineering values;
  2. Two sets of register maps exist: Old map (Firmware ≤2008) / New map (Firmware ≥2009). The table below is the new standard register map used for most field devices.
  3. Default Communication Parameters

Slave address: 1

Taxa de transmissão: 9600

Data bits: 8, Stop bits: 1, Paridade: Nenhum

Parameters can be modified via front panel menu

  1. Common Real-Time Measurement Registers (PDU Offset, FC03)
PDU OffsetReg CountNome do parâmetroScaling FactorUnidadeData Type
7862L1-N Voltage U1/100VS32
7882L2-N Voltage U2/100VS32
7902L3-N Voltage U3/100VS32
7922L1-L2 Line Voltage U12/100VS32
7942L2-L3 Line Voltage U23/100VS32
7962L3-L1 Line Voltage U31/100VS32
7982Phase A Current I1/100UMS32
8002Phase B Current I2/100UMS32
8022Phase C Current I3/100UMS32
8042Freqüência/100HzS32
8062Total Active Power ΣP/100kWS32
8082Total Reactive Power ΣQ/100esquerdaS32
8102Total Apparent Power ΣS/100kVAS32
8122Total Power Factor PF/1000-S32
8142L1 Active Power P1/100kWS32
8162L2 Active Power P2/100kWS32
8182L3 Active Power P3/100kWS32
  1. Energy Metering Registers (Energy Counter, 32-bit Unsigned)
PDU OffsetReg CountNome do parâmetroUnidadeScaling
8602Import Active Energy kWh+kWhRaw value direct use
8622Export Active Energy kWh-kWhRaw value direct use
8642Inductive Reactive Energy kvarh+kvarhRaw value direct use
8662Capacitive Reactive Energy kvarh-kvarhRaw value direct use
8562Operating Hour Counterh/100

⚠️ Model 48250201 basic version has no pulse output or DI/DO; I/O status registers are not required.

  1. Reading Example

Read Total Active Power: Offset address 806, read 2 consecutive registers

Returned data [High Word, Low Word] forms a 32-bit integer → Value ÷100 = kW

Exemplo: Raw reading = 12560 → 12560 /100 = 125.60 kW

  1. Armadilhas Comuns & Notas
  2. Word Order: DIRIS A40 uses Big-Endian (high register = high 16-bit). Most configuration software supports this natively; some drivers require manual swap of high/low word.
  3. Incompatibility between old and new firmware register maps

All readings equal zero: Likely old firmware register map (starts at 0x700).

  1. CT/PT Ratio: After ratio setting inside the meter, register values already represent primary-side actual values. Do NOT multiply by transformer ratio again.
  2. Avoid reading excessive continuous registers in one request; limit to ≤20 registers per command to prevent communication errors.
  3. Extended registers for harmonic, THD, maximum demand and event logs are available and generally unnecessary for conventional data acquisition.
  4. Access Official Full PDF Document

Official Manual Reference: 536103B (DIRIS A40/A41 Modbus communication manual), containing complete register list, alarm parameters and write registers.

Procedure to Modify RS485 Modbus Communication Parameters via Front Panel for SOCOMEC DIRIS A40 (48250201)

Front Panel Button Definition (96×96 Model)

◀ LEFT: Cursor left / Scroll up

▶ RIGHT: Cursor right / Enter & Confirmar

▲ UP: Value increase / Scroll up

▼ DOWN: Value decrease / Scroll down

Default Administrator Password: 100

Default Communication Settings: Slave address=1, Baud rate=9600, Data bits=8, Stop bits=1, Parity=None

Step-by-Step Operation

Etapa 1: Enter Configuration Menu

Meter displays normal measurement screen (voltage/current view)

  1. Pressão longa [▶ RIGHT] confirm key for 3~5 seconds
  2. Screen prompts CODE ?, password input required

Etapa 2: Input Password 100

▲ UP: Increment digit

▶ RIGHT: Shift cursor to next digit

Set digits sequentially: `1` → `0` → `0`

After input, long press [▶ RIGHT] to enter main configuration menu

Etapa 3: Navigate to Communication Menu

Scroll using ▲ / ▼ to locate:

RS485 COMMUNICATION

Press ▶ RIGHT to enter submenu

Etapa 4: Modify Communication Parameters Item by Item

Four configurable items:

  1. COM ADR (Modbus Slave Address)

Faixa: 1~247. Ensure unique address for each meter on the bus.

▶ Enter → Adjust value via ▲▼ → ▶ Confirm

  1. BAUD (Taxa de transmissão)

Opções: 1200 / 2400 / 4800 / 9600 / 19200 / 38400 / 57600 /115200

  1. PARITY

NÃO: No parity (Recommended for site use)

EVEN: Even parity

ODD: dd parity

  1. STOP BIT

1 / 2; Standard site setting: 1

⚠️ Critical: Host device (PLC/Gateway/Modbus Poll) parameters must match the meter exactly, otherwise communication failure occurs.

Etapa 5: Save and Exit

After all parameters modified:

  1. Scroll to EXIT using ▲▼
  2. Press ▶ RIGHT to confirm exit
  3. Prompt SAVE? YES/NO

Select YES to save; select NO to discard all changes.

After successful saving, meter automatically returns to measurement main screen. New communication settings take effect immediately.

⚠️ Common Faults & Reminders

  1. Forgotten Password 100

Panel modification unavailable. Two solutions:

① Use Easy Config software via RS485 to read or reset password;

② Factory reset (CT ratio, energy data will be cleared. Proceed with caution).

  1. Troubleshooting checklist if communication fails after parameter modification

No duplicated slave addresses; taxa de transmissão, parity and stop bits fully matched

RS485 wiring: A to A, B to B. Do not reverse polarity

120Ω terminating resistor at bus end to be deployed as required

Confirm model 48250201 integrates built-in RS485; no extra communication module required

  1. Menu Language

Older firmware: English menu `RS485 COMM`

Newer firmware: Chinese menu supported RS485通讯

Recommended Parameter Template

ParâmetroRecommended Setting
Slave AddressAssign according to site layout (1~247)
Taxa de transmissão9600
Parity PARITYNÃO (Nenhum)
Stop Bit STOP1
